The Type 2 Diabetes Score in 80133, Palmer Lake, Colorado is 65 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
92.83 percent of the population in 80133 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 59.94 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 7.40 percent of the residents in 80133 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.23 members with about 2.52 cars available per household.
An estimate of 95.08 percent of the residents in 80133 has some form of health insurance. 29.02 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 73.92 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 80133 would have to travel an average of 19.67 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Centura Castle Rock Adventist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 80133, Palmer Lake, Colorado.

As of , an estimate of 2,519 residents live in 80133 with a median age of 50.6 years. 11.43 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 16.12 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 40.39 percent of the residents in 80133 is currently married, and 17.15 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 80133 is $8,828.17.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 80133 is approximately $1,242. The median household spends about 14.07 percent of their income on housing.
